Raag Wadahans - Part 026

582 : 939
Come, O Baba, and Siblings of Destiny - let's join together; take me in your arms, and bless me with your prayers.

582 : 940
O Baba, union with the True Lord cannot be broken; bless me with your prayers for union with my Beloved.

582 : 941
Bless me with your prayers, that I may perform devotional worship service to my Lord; for those already united with Him, what is there to unite?

582 : 942
Some have wandered away from the Name of the Lord, and lost the Path. The Word of the Guru's Shabad is the true game.

582 : 943
Do not go on Death's path; remain merged in the Word of the Shabad, the true form throughout the ages.

582 : 944
Through good fortune, we meet such friends and relatives, who meet with the Guru, and escape the noose of Death. ||2||

582 : 945
O Baba, we come into the world naked, into pain and pleasure, according to the record of our account.

582 : 946
The call of our pre-ordained destiny cannot be altered; it follows from our past actions.

582 : 947
The True Lord sits and writes of ambrosial nectar, and bitter poison; as the Lord attaches us, so are we attached.

582 : 948
The Charmer, Maya, has worked her charms, and the multi-colored thread is around everyone's neck.

582 : 949
Through shallow intellect, the mind becomes shallow, and one eats the fly, along with the sweets.

582 : 950
Contrary to custom, he comes into the Dark Age of Kali Yuga naked, and naked he is bound down and sent away again. ||3||

582 : 951
O Baba, weep and mourn if you must; the beloved soul is bound and driven off.

582 : 952
The pre-ordained record of destiny cannot be erased; the summons has come from the Lord's Court.

582 : 953
The messenger comes, when it pleases the Lord, and the mourners begin to mourn.

582 : 954
Sons, brothers, nephews and very dear friends weep and wail.

582 : 955
Let him weep, who weeps in the Fear of God, cherishing the virtues of God. No one dies with the dead.

O Nanak, throughout the ages, they are known as wise, who weep, remembering the True Lord. ||4||5||

582 : 957
Wadahans, Third Mehl:

582 : 958
One Universal Creator God. By The Grace Of The True Guru:

582 : 959
Praise God, the True Lord; He is all-powerful to do all things.

582 : 960
The soul-bride shall never be a widow, and she shall never have to endure suffering.

582 : 961
She shall never suffer - night and day, she enjoys pleasures; that soul-bride merges in the Mansion of her Lord's Presence.

582 : 962
She knows her Beloved, the Architect of karma, and she speaks words of ambrosial sweetness.

582 : 963
The virtuous soul-brides dwell on the Lord's virtues; they keep their Husband Lord in their remembrance, and so they never suffer separation from Him.

582 : 964
So praise your True Husband Lord, who is all-powerful to do all things. ||1||

582 : 965
The True Lord and Master is realized through the Word of His Shabad; He blends all with Himself.

582 : 966
That soul-bride is imbued with the Love of her Husband Lord, who banishes her self-conceit from within.

582 : 967
Eradicating her ego from within herself, death shall not consume her again; as Gurmukh, she knows the One Lord God.

582 : 968
The desire of the soul-bride is fulfilled; deep within herself, she is drenched in His Love. She meets the Great Giver, the Life of the World.

582 : 969
Imbued with love for the Shabad, she is like a youth intoxicated; she merges into the very being of her Husband Lord.

582 : 970
The True Lord Master is realized through the Word of His Shabad. He blends all with Himself. ||2||

582 : 971
Those who have realized their Husband Lord - I go and ask those Saints about Him.
